EDITORS COMMENTS
This print depicts a pivotal moment in the history of India during the Battle of Meeanee in Sind, which took place on 17th February 1843. The British and Indian forces, led by the esteemed General Sir Charles Napier, are seen engaging in fierce combat against the Beluchis, who were fiercely led by their Emirs. The Sind Campaign, as it came to be known, was a significant military operation initiated by the British East India Company to expand its territorial control in the region. However, this image does not focus on the Company's commercial interests but instead highlights the military aspect of this event. General Napier, a highly decorated military leader, had been appointed as the Commander-in-Chief in India in 1842 with the specific objective of subduing the rebellious Emirs of Sind. The Battle of Meeanee was the culmination of a series of skirmishes and sieges that lasted for several months. The print vividly portrays the intensity of the battlefield, with soldiers from both sides locked in hand-to-hand combat. The British and Indian troops, dressed in their distinctive uniforms, are seen charging forward with swords and muskets, while the Beluchis, clad in traditional attire, wield spears and shields. The chaos and confusion of the battle are palpable, with smoke rising from the gunpowder explosions and the cacophony of war drums and gunfire filling the air. The Battle of Meeanee marked a decisive victory for the British and Indian forces, paving the way for the eventual conquest of Sind. This print serves as a poignant reminder of the rich and complex history of India and the pivotal role that military campaigns played in shaping its future.
